Butterfly Challenge #117

I think I've just about managed to sneak in at the end of the time with a card for the Butterfly challenge.  We are on the letter 'A' this time with a choice of any or all of aperture, almond, apple green, amber, acetate, anything.  I've managed to use all but the acetate on my card where I started by cutting a shaped aperture from a piece of almond pearlescent card, popping in a piece of card which I'd coloured with Oxide inks and Pixie powders (amber and apple green).  A two layer butterfly was die cut using some of the same coloured card with a scrap of green for the top layer,  To add some interest I punched some fancy corners onto the almond coloured card and tied a green/yellow ribbon around (ribbon = anything).  I decided to leave this card without a sentiment because it is always handy to have a few cards in case anyone wants one in which they can write their own message not related to any particular occasion.  There is still just about time to take part in this challenge if you are quick and Mrs. A has made some great cards for inspiration - prizes to be had as well, so win, win situation!


Aperture - punch from Sue Wilson Greek Island collection Kefalonia
Butterfly - Tm Holtz die
Corner Punch - Stampin' Up
